PET

Positron Emission Tomography, a type of nuclear medicine imaging test that helps visualize body functions, such as blood flow, oxygen use, and sugar metabolism, to help doctors evaluate how well organs and tissues are functioning.

Gamma Waves

Brainwave frequencies above 30 Hz, associated with consciousness, attention, learning, and problem-solving.

Neurotransmitter Inhibitors

Substances or drugs that hinder the release, synthesis, or function of neurotransmitters, affecting communication between nerve cells.
